Smokey Mountain National Park Over
fall break Ferrum Outdoors took several students to enjoy the splendor
of The Great Smoky Mountains National Park. It is recognized by the
United Nations as an international biosphere and annually has more visitors
(9 million) than any other park in the United States. International
students Yun Zhu from China and Miranda Havlin from Ireland had a wonderful
time. Yun enjoyed her first ever-camping experience. Roasting marshmallows
and the beauty of the mountains were two of her favorite things about
the experience. Miranda has been involved with the Scouts in Ireland,
so she was an old pro at camping. One of her favorite things was learning
more about the geography of the Smoky Mountains as she is studying to
teach geography back in Ireland. Barak Brashear is a student leader
in the Parks, Recreation, and Tourism Management Program at Ferrum College.
Barak helped plan and organize the trip to the Smoky Mountains. Last
year he came to Ferrum Outdoors with the idea for this trip. This year,
working on his internship he was able to implement the idea.
